ABSTRACT

The divergent opinion on the financial reporting practice of pension funds administrators has been an ongoing issue. Academic scholars overtime have been groping with what factors drive the financial performance of pension funds administrators which still remains unestablished. Hence, this study determines the effect of financial reporting practices on the financial pension funds administrators in Nigeria. The study employed correlational research design while the population of the study is the 20 registered and licensed Pension Funds Administrators in Nigeria and a sample of eleven (11) PFAs were conveniently selected after filter was applied. A multiple regression was adopted as a technique of data analysis of the study. The findings reveal that firm size is statistically insignificant in influencing the performance of PFAs, while firm growth, institutional shareholding, managerial shareholding and leverage have significant negative impact on the performance of PFAs. The study recommended among others that, the Management of PFAs should increase their net assets in order to expand their size and improve performance. Again, as more levered PFAs tend to have better performance, their Management should use less equity financing and increase debt to improve their performance.
